ichanged logging format - fiche - A pastebin adjusted for gopher use Err vernunftzentrum.de 70 hgit clone git://vernunftzentrum.de/fiche.git URL:git://vernunftzentrum.de/fiche.git vernunftzentrum.de 70 1Log /ckeen/repos/fiche/log.gph vernunftzentrum.de 70 1Files /ckeen/repos/fiche/files.gph vernunftzentrum.de 70 1Refs /ckeen/repos/fiche/refs.gph vernunftzentrum.de 70 1LICENSE /ckeen/repos/fiche/file/LICENSE.gph vernunftzentrum.de 70 i--- Err vernunftzentrum.de 70 1commit 157353707e17bc4c8ac4dd6743711bedb7a5a526 /ckeen/repos/fiche/commit/157353707e17bc4c8ac4dd6743711bedb7a5a526.gph vernunftzentrum.de 70 1parent 1d425525a1cdc53210a94c1288ab580aab5fb1ab /ckeen/repos/fiche/commit/1d425525a1cdc53210a94c1288ab580aab5fb1ab.gph vernunftzentrum.de 70 hAuthor: solusipse URL:mailto:solus1ps3@gmail.com vernunftzentrum.de 70 iDate: Tue, 9 Sep 2014 03:26:21 +0200 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 ichanged logging format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 iDiffstat: Err vernunftzentrum.de 70 i fiche.c | 15 +++++++++------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i1 file changed, 9 insertions(+), 6 deletions(-) Err vernunftzentrum.de 70 i--- Err vernunftzentrum.de 70 1diff --git a/fiche.c b/fiche.c /ckeen/repos/fiche/file/fiche.c.gph vernunftzentrum.de 70 i@@ -131,18 +131,21 @@ void perform_connection(int listen_socket)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i void display_date() Err vernunftzentrum.de 70 i { Err vernunftzentrum.de 70 i- printf("%s", get_date()); Err vernunftzentrum.de 70 i+ printf("%s\n", get_date()); Err vernunftzentrum.de 70 i }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i char *get_date() Err vernunftzentrum.de 70 i { Err vernunftzentrum.de 70 i time_t rawtime; Err vernunftzentrum.de 70 i struct tm *timeinfo; Err vernunftzentrum.de 70 i+ char *timechar;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i time(&rawtime); Err vernunftzentrum.de 70 i timeinfo = localtime(&rawtime); Err vernunftzentrum.de 70 i+ timechar = asctime(timeinfo); Err vernunftzentrum.de 70 i+ timechar[strlen(timechar)-1] = 0;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i- return asctime(timeinfo); Err vernunftzentrum.de 70 i+ return timechar; Err vernunftzentrum.de 70 i }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i struct client_data get_client_address(struct sockaddr_in client_address) Err vernunftzentrum.de 70 i@@ -155,7 +158,7 @@ struct client_data get_client_address(struct sockaddr_in client_address) Err vernunftzentrum.de 70 i if (hostp == NULL) Err vernunftzentrum.de 70 i { Err vernunftzentrum.de 70 i printf("ERROR: Couldn't obtain client's hostname\n"); Err vernunftzentrum.de 70 i- data.hostname = "error"; Err vernunftzentrum.de 70 i+ data.hostname = "n/a"; Err vernunftzentrum.de 70 i } Err vernunftzentrum.de 70 i else Err vernunftzentrum.de 70 i data.hostname = hostp->h_name; Err vernunftzentrum.de 70 i@@ -164,7 +167,7 @@ struct client_data get_client_address(struct sockaddr_in client_address) Err vernunftzentrum.de 70 i if (hostaddrp == NULL) Err vernunftzentrum.de 70 i { Err vernunftzentrum.de 70 i printf("ERROR: Couldn't obtain client's address\n"); Err vernunftzentrum.de 70 i- data.ip_address = "error"; Err vernunftzentrum.de 70 i+ data.ip_address = "n/a"; Err vernunftzentrum.de 70 i } Err vernunftzentrum.de 70 i else Err vernunftzentrum.de 70 i data.ip_address = hostaddrp; Err vernunftzentrum.de 70 i@@ -179,9 +182,9 @@ void save_log(char *slug, char *hostaddrp, char *h_name) Err vernunftzentrum.de 70 i char contents[256];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i if (slug != NULL) Err vernunftzentrum.de 70 i- snprintf(contents, sizeof contents, "\n%s%s|%s|%s%s", get_date(), slug, hostaddrp, h_name, return_line()); Err vernunftzentrum.de 70 i+ snprintf(contents, sizeof contents, "%s -- %s -- %s (%s)\n", slug, get_date(), hostaddrp, h_name); Err vernunftzentrum.de 70 i else Err vernunftzentrum.de 70 i- snprintf(contents, sizeof contents, "\n%s%s|%s|%s%s", get_date(), "rejected", hostaddrp, h_name, return_line()); Err vernunftzentrum.de 70 i+ snprintf(contents, sizeof contents, "%s -- %s -- %s (%s)\n", "rej", get_date(), hostaddrp, h_name); Err vernunftzentrum.de 70 i Err vernunftzentrum.de 70 i FILE *fp; Err vernunftzentrum.de 70 i fp = fopen(LOG, "a"); Err vernunftzentrum.de 70 .